Increasing Storage Capacity

Deep freezers are like the Mary Poppins bags of the freezer world—holding way more than the typical freezer stuck in a fridge. Check out some average sizes you might come across:

Freezer Style Space in Cubic Feet Best For
Chest Freezer 5 - 25 Big families, bargain shoppers
Upright Freezer 3 - 20 Tight kitchen spaces
Deep Freezer Combo Units 5 - 14 Adding to fridge storage

This extra space is great for hoarding everything from frozen veggies to that delicious lasagna you made last week. It makes whipping up dinner a less stressful, more grab-and-go affair.

Organizing Food Efficiently

Getting a handle on your deep freezer’s chaos reduces the odds of food playing hide and seek, so here’s how to keep everything neat and easy to grab:

  • Category Zones: Group hamburger patties with chicken wings, veggies with veggies—it's like a party where everyone knows where they belong.
  • Labels Are Your Friends: Scribble the contents and best-before dates on your containers. No more mystery meals!
  • Divide and Conquer with Bins: Bins or baskets can help you section off areas for different types of foods.
  • FIFO for the Win: Let the oldest food items step up first to the dining plate. It’s all about “first in, first out.”

Minimizing Food Waste

Nobody likes tossing food, and your deep freezer is like a pause button for all those tasty bites you weren't able to finish. It’s your trusty sidekick that rescues leftovers or items creeping up on their expiration date. Moving them to your deep freeze gives 'em a new life.

Fruits and veggies, oh, they hold onto their yumminess and nutrition! You can enjoy them when the mood strikes, without worrying about them going bad in the fridge. Here's a quick peek at how these goodies last chillin' in the freezer Vs. hanging out in the fridge:

Food Item Fresh Fridge Shelf Life Frozen Shelf Life
Chicken 1-2 days 6-12 months
Broccoli 3-5 days 10-12 months
Pizza 3-5 days 1-2 months
Soups and Stews 3-4 days 2-3 months
